A plastic sheet with a built-in sensitivity used to reproduce copy when exposed to heat and light radiations. It is designed for use with a COPYING MACHINE, THERMOGRAPHIC PROCESS. Excludes FILM, PHOTOGRAPHIC. View more Thermographic Process Copying Film

7530-01-381-1959 is a Thermographic Process Copying Film that does not have a nuclear hardened feature or any other critical feature such as tolerance, fit restriction or application. Demilitarization of this item has been confirmed and is not currently subject to changes. This item is considered a low risk when released from the control of the Department of Defense. The item may still be subject to the requirements of the Export Administration Regulations (EAR) and the Code of Federal Regulations (CFR). This item may be hazardous as it is in a Federal Supply Class for potentially hazardous items. A MSDS should be available from the supplier for the end user to evaluate any hazards. This item does not contain a precious metal.
